    Intentional action processing results from automatic bottom-up attention: An EEG-investigation into the Social Relevance Hypothesis using hypnosis.Eleonore Neufeld, Elliot C. Brown, Sie-In Lee-Grimm, Albert Newen & Martin Brüne - 2016 - Consciousness and Cognition 42:101-112.
    Social stimuli grab our attention: we attend to them in an automatic and bottom-up manner, and ascribe them a higher degree of saliency compared to non-social stimuli. However, it has rarely been investigated how variations in attention affect the processing of social stimuli, although the answer could help us uncover details of social cognition processes such as action understanding. In the present study, we examined how changes to bottom-up attention affects neural EEG-responses associated with intentional action (...). We induced an increase in bottom-up attention by using hypnosis. We recorded the electroencephalographic µ-wave suppression of hypnotized participants when presented with intentional actions in first and third person perspective in a video-clip paradigm. Previous studies have shown that the µ-rhythm is selectively suppressed both when executing and observing goal-directed motor actions; hence it can be used as a neural signal for intentional action processing. Our results show that neutral hypnotic trance increases µ-suppression in highly suggestible participants when they observe intentional actions. This suggests that social action processing is enhanced when bottom-up attentional processes are predominant. Our findings support the Social Relevance Hypothesis, according to which social action processing is a bottom-up driven attentional process, and can thus be altered as a function of bottom-up processing devoted to a social stimulus.     Processing Coordinated Structures: Incrementality and Connectedness.Patrick Sturt & Vincenzo Lombardo - 2005 - Cognitive Science 29 (2):291-305.
    We recorded participants' eye movements while they read sentences containing verb‐phrase coordination. Results showed evidence of immediate processing disruption when a reflexive pronoun embedded in the conjoined verb phrase mismatched the sentence subject. We argue that this result is incompatible with models of human parsing that employ only bottom‐up parsing procedures, even when flexible constituency is employed. Models need to incorporate a mechanism similar to the adjoining operation in Tree‐Adjoining Grammar, in which one structure is inserted into another.

    Recognition of continuous speech requires top-down processing.Kenneth N. Stevens - 2000 - Behavioral and Brain Sciences 23 (3):348-348.
    The proposition that feedback is never necessary in speech recognition is examined for utterances consisting of sequences of words. In running speech the features near word boundaries are often modified according to language-dependent rules. Application of these rules during word recognition requires top-down processing. Because isolated words are not usually modified by rules, their recognition could be achieved by bottom-up processing only.

    Gamma rhythms as liminal operators in sensory processing.Miles A. Whittington - 2004 - Behavioral and Brain Sciences 27 (6):807-808.
    Gamma rhythms are associated with external and internal sensory processing. Within the conceptual framework of “top-down” and “bottom-up” processing, this suggests that gamma represents a format common to both camps. As these oscillations facilitate communication in the temporal domain, they may represent a mechanism by which top-down and bottom-up processing can interact. A breakdown in this interaction may lead to hallucinations.
